July Weather in Tecate, Mexico

Last updated: April 22, 2025

In July, Tecate, Mexico experiences warm and dry weather, with maximum temperatures reaching 41°C (107°F), and an average of 25°C (76°F). The nights offer a cooler respite, with minimum temperatures around 11°C (52°F). Rainfall is minimal, totaling just 11 mm (0.4 in) across only 2 days, while humidity averages 46%, adding a touch of comfort to the summer heat. This combination of high temperatures and low precipitation makes July an excellent time for outdoor activities in this vibrant region.

July UV Index in Tecate

In July, Tecate, Mexico experiences a UV Index of 12, categorized as extreme, which means sun exposure can lead to potential skin damage within just 10 minutes. This benchmark of intensity has been consistent since May, where the index first peaked at this high level, continuing through June and August as well. The summer months lead the year in UV exposure, with the preceding months of March and April also showing significantly high indices of 9 and 11, respectively. UV Risk Categories

  •  Extreme (11+): Avoid the sun, stay in shade.
  •  Very High (8-10): Limit sun exposure.
  •  High (6-7): Use SPF 30+ and protective clothing.
  •  Moderate (3-5): Midday shade recommended.
  •  Low (0-2): No protection needed.
